Great article over the #Technician shortage. We are doing what we can at the high school level. It is hard to train upcoming technicians with 20 year old vehicles. High School #Automotive programs need help from @GM @Ford @Toyota @NissanUSA @Dodge etc. financially and donations.

Auto dealerships are facing a shortage of technicians to fix cars. Here's why
Auto dealerships, like many industries, are feeling the effects of what some have termed the Great Resignation, in which workers are quitting at steep rates.
